Many of the teams that had planned to partake in the 2015 International Champions Cup - the annual preseason tournament that takes place, primarily, in North America - were already know.
Barcelona, Manchester United, Chelsea, Paris Saint-Germain. All had previously confirmed their involvement.
Tuesday, we learned when, where, and against whom their respective matches will take place, as the complete schedule for the tournament was unveiled.

The highlights include a pair of contests involving Barcelona, who will meet Manchester United at Levi's Stadium on July 25 and Chelsea at FedExField on July 28.

The Spanish giants will also take on MLS' perennial power, as the Los Angeles Galaxy will take on the Blaugrana at the Rose Bowl on July 21.
